講演テーマ:
The role of interfaces and defects on halfmetallic
heterostructures
Abstract:
Halfmetallic materials have attracted significant research
attention research in the past decade due to their predicted
100% spin polarisation. The halfmetals incorporation in
heterostructure devices is very demanding since it requires
atomic control of the interfaces and structure of the
layers. In this talk I will present a correlation between
the functionality of model spintronic devices and their
atomic structure, with special focus on the effect of
intrinsic defects and interfaces on halfmetallicity and
ultimately on device performance.
